Fastener Tightening Specifications
2004 Oldsmobile Bravada RWDSECTION Fastener Tightening Specifications
WARNING: This page is about a different car, the 2002 Oldsmobile Bravada, 2002 GMC Envoy XL, 2002 GMC Envoy, and 2002 Chevrolet TrailBlazer. However, it is still accessible from the selected car via links, so may be relevant.
Fastener Tightening Specifications
| Application | Specification | |
|---|---|---|
| Metric | English | |
| EBCM to BPMV | 5 N.m | 39 lb in |
| EHCU to Bracket | 9 N.m | 7 lb ft |
| EHCU Bracket Mounting Bolts | 25 N.m | 18 lb ft |
| Front Brake Lines to BPMV | 24 N.m | 18 lb ft |
| Front Wheel Speed Sensor Mounting Bolt | 17 N.m | 12 lb ft |
| Master Cylinder brake lines to BPMV | 24 N.m | 18 lb ft |
| Rear Brake Line to BPMV | 24 N.m | 18 lb ft |
| Steering Knuckle to Front Hub/Bearing Mounting Bolts | 180 N.m | 133 lb ft |
